Default ROI Results 11/16 @ Del Mar

Del Mar started off our new handicapping year and one player started it off with a bang. Four
winners were found in the ROI and two players made them count. Both Ruffian and Cruzan
just missed on a double digit horse which could have put them in the money and the rest of
us just were spectators at beautiful Del Mar. Cruzan did cash a ticket but it only put him at
the top of the also rans. Cruzan hit his winner in the 8th worth $50. Joly B took second place
on the day when he hit the exacta in the Bob Hope worth $103.50. Sadly it wasn't the exacta
payout in the 8th but his total return. Cal takes the win and continues his hot streak going into
our 2020 season. Cal nailed his two winners in the 7th with a trifecta and a superfecta. The
5-7-8-1 combo returned to Cal $428 for the tri and $183 for the super. Nicely played Cal.
Congrats on a big win and a little cushion to start off a positive ROI year. Following are the
unofficial results pending an objection against the scorer. With such an overwhelming win
I doubt anyone can object to Cal's romp. Congrats also to Don Guido on his points win.
See you next week at the track of Don's choice. While pickings are slim this time oif the
year you never know where a future star might show up.
